Revision tracking
See what changed between issues, clouded or not.
Reissued sets land without clouds. A slab level moves, a hob shifts, a note changes, and the transmittal says nothing. CIM puts two issues side by side, boxes every change on the sheet and feeds a change register with the sheet and revision behind each item.

The old way
Unclouded changes surface on site, or at the final account
The cloud is missing, and so is the change
The transmittal lists the sheets that changed. A moved slab level or a rewritten note on them is left to the reader to find.
Nobody has the days to re-check every sheet
So the set goes through on faith that the consultant clouded their own work.
The variation cannot be substantiated
The change register is kept by hand when there is time. Without the revision and what it was priced against, the claim is an argument.
